Trends for Processor speeds

Not related to a specific OLAP tool. (Includes forum policies and rules).
Post Reply
User avatar
Steve Rowe
Site Admin
Posts: 2410
Joined: Wed May 14, 2008 4:25 pm
OLAP Product: TM1
Version: TM1 v6,v7,v8,v9,v10,v11+PAW
Excel Version: Nearly all of them

Trends for Processor speeds

Post by Steve Rowe »

Just wanted to ask what peoples views were on Processor speeds.

It seems to me that the current trend for many processors running at 3GHz does not serve a product like TM1 well. The max speed of a processor seems to be stalled around the 3GHz mark and the hardware industry seems to be focussed on multiple processors in a box rather than the speed.

Obviously these type of servers have their place but I'd much rather have a twin 4GHz than 8 3GHz processors as I think (guess really) my user base would be better served by a server like this.

Anyone else have comments or views?

Cheers,
Technical Director
www.infocat.co.uk
User avatar
jim wood
Site Admin
Posts: 3951
Joined: Wed May 14, 2008 1:51 pm
OLAP Product: TM1
Version: PA 2.0.7
Excel Version: Office 365
Location: 37 East 18th Street New York
Contact:

Re: Trends for Processor speeds

Post by jim wood »

I guess for TM1 you are right. (Based on the current architecture) May be instead of looking at the frozen speed of modern CPU's, IBM should instead work on changing how TM1 handles multiple threads. The CPU and software industry have been moving this way for some time. Come to think of it where is a version of TM1 that works on Linux? Many businesses are moving their servers over to the likes of Red Hat (Especially Solaris based companies).
Struggling through the quagmire of life to reach the other side of who knows where.
Shop at Amazon
Jimbo PC Builds on YouTube
OS: Mac OS 11 PA Version: 2.0.7
User avatar
Steve Vincent
Site Admin
Posts: 1054
Joined: Mon May 12, 2008 8:33 am
OLAP Product: TM1
Version: 10.2.2 FP1
Excel Version: 2010
Location: UK

Re: Trends for Processor speeds

Post by Steve Vincent »

I guess it comes down to the CPU architecture. There is a cracking article on wikipedia about CPUs (for uber-geeks only!) but the general issue seems to be greater clocks > greater heat. From 3GHz onwards you are looking at serious cooling solutions and in a server room where rack space is limited i guess that starts to be a factor in CPU choice. Its generally a better solution for most programmes / systems to go multi-threading rather than push the cycles as that reaps better rewards compared to the issues with greater clocks. Its just the way TM1 works, it cannot utilise the architecture as efficiently so it benefits less.

Victim of its own success maybe? :|
If this were a dictatorship, it would be a heck of a lot easier, just so long as I'm the dictator.
Production: Planning Analytics 64 bit 2.0.5, Windows 2016 Server. Excel 2016, IE11 for t'internet
User avatar
jim wood
Site Admin
Posts: 3951
Joined: Wed May 14, 2008 1:51 pm
OLAP Product: TM1
Version: PA 2.0.7
Excel Version: Office 365
Location: 37 East 18th Street New York
Contact:

Re: Trends for Processor speeds

Post by jim wood »

From what I rember it's top do with the number of silicon wafers on one die. The more you have, the more it heats up. As for TM1, as I said above it needs to handle multi-thrweading better. Sitting there watching task manager use all of one cpu while the others are idle can be most distressing. They have managed to solve locking, why not multi-threading next?
Struggling through the quagmire of life to reach the other side of who knows where.
Shop at Amazon
Jimbo PC Builds on YouTube
OS: Mac OS 11 PA Version: 2.0.7
User avatar
Steve Vincent
Site Admin
Posts: 1054
Joined: Mon May 12, 2008 8:33 am
OLAP Product: TM1
Version: 10.2.2 FP1
Excel Version: 2010
Location: UK

Re: Trends for Processor speeds

Post by Steve Vincent »

this could get horribly technical, but i can see why they haven't ;)

threading is most useful when you have multiple tasks to do that are independant of each other. Unless you have a TM1 model where no cubes have rules or TIs that make them reliant upon each other, or share the same dimensions, i can't see how they can make proper use of threading. It would have to try and calculate 2 cubes until it found a dependancy on something then wait before continuing. How the blazes could they work that out when they can't write automatic feeders?! :lol:
If this were a dictatorship, it would be a heck of a lot easier, just so long as I'm the dictator.
Production: Planning Analytics 64 bit 2.0.5, Windows 2016 Server. Excel 2016, IE11 for t'internet
User avatar
jim wood
Site Admin
Posts: 3951
Joined: Wed May 14, 2008 1:51 pm
OLAP Product: TM1
Version: PA 2.0.7
Excel Version: Office 365
Location: 37 East 18th Street New York
Contact:

Re: Trends for Processor speeds

Post by jim wood »

Good point. They may have to sort both problems if they are going to utilise the product as they (IBM) have in mind. Here's to holding my breathe. (Not really)
Struggling through the quagmire of life to reach the other side of who knows where.
Shop at Amazon
Jimbo PC Builds on YouTube
OS: Mac OS 11 PA Version: 2.0.7
User avatar
Steve Rowe
Site Admin
Posts: 2410
Joined: Wed May 14, 2008 4:25 pm
OLAP Product: TM1
Version: TM1 v6,v7,v8,v9,v10,v11+PAW
Excel Version: Nearly all of them

Re: Trends for Processor speeds

Post by Steve Rowe »

Yes better multi-threading is OK up to a point, but it's only useful for
1. Deliver cached numbers to many users at the same time.
2. Calculating independent set of numbers.

In general terms 2 isn't that common in my experience. We are still left with a lack of raw grunt power these days, especially as we move into 64 bit world with larger models based on more detail.

I'm really disappointed with the speed of my current hardware and all it's doing is adding consolidations no rules or anything.

Can you even buy "fast" processors???
Cheers
Technical Director
www.infocat.co.uk
User avatar
jim wood
Site Admin
Posts: 3951
Joined: Wed May 14, 2008 1:51 pm
OLAP Product: TM1
Version: PA 2.0.7
Excel Version: Office 365
Location: 37 East 18th Street New York
Contact:

Re: Trends for Processor speeds

Post by jim wood »

It's called £800 of quad core with water cooling. Your boss think your building a gaming rig though!! :mrgreen:
Struggling through the quagmire of life to reach the other side of who knows where.
Shop at Amazon
Jimbo PC Builds on YouTube
OS: Mac OS 11 PA Version: 2.0.7
Post Reply